Storyboard


To visualize the opening sequences, it is crucial to illustrate the ideas. This allows for a clearer explanation of my concepts, encompassing decisions regarding desired camera angles, shot types and sizes, colour editing, the flow of the story, character placement, and character appearances. The storyboard serves as more than just an overview and brief description for the audience; it also acts as a powerful tool for our production crew to plan, organize, and prepare for the film project.


Of course, there were multiple changes and group discussions in this stage, our teams came up with many ideas, and my crewmate - Lucy, the one to assist in this part, had drawn 3 storyboards. They all have different styles of drawing and a bit of add-in, cutting off details to make the opening sequence more suitable and ensure it's within the time frame, but the main story and message still remain the same.
